FanDuel did not take long to announce its Missouri sports betting partner after missing out on an untethered license.
FanDuel has entered into an agreement with Major League Soccer’s St. Louis City SC to access Missouri’s newly regulated sports betting market, just hours after being denied an untethered digital license by the state’s regulators.

The Missouri Gaming Commission selected DraftKings and Circa Sports as the winners of the state's two coveted untethered online sports betting licenses.

DraftKings and Circa Sports win Missouri’s untethered mobile sports betting licenses, set to launch December 1, 2025.
The Missouri Gaming Commission heard presentations Wednesday from DraftKings, FanDuel and Circa Sports, three companies competing for two mobile sports betting licenses available in the state.
